Key Advantages
Transfer Data Fast With a 12 Gb/s SAS Interface. Get data to applications when and where it’s needed with up to 12 Gb/s speed, unprecedented capacity, and effective maximum throughput of 14.4 GB/s in a single I/O module or 28.8 GB/s in a dual controller configuration. Even with expansion capability up to 336 hard drives or solid state drives, there is no sacrifice of space for performance.
Deliver a Versatile Architecture Built to Grow. Minimise your TCO and store up to 1.1 PB of data with an enclosure that leads the industry in both density and cost-for-performance while enabling easy expansion via interchangeable FRUs and SBB 2.0 compatibility. This flexible enclosure includes support and capabilities to manage cables, universal ports, self-configuration controls, and standardised zoning while helping you accelerate market introduction of new technologies and significantly simplify development and testing of storage implementations.
Ensure Applications Have Access to Critical Data. Safeguard your data with fault diagnosis, resolution capabilities, persistent error logging, and monitoring while ensuring maximum availability while harnessing high-availability features such as dual cooling, PCMs, and I/O modules, as well as dual data paths to all drives.

Specifications | 0 | |
Controller | Dual EBOD storage bridge bay (SBB) 2.1 compatible I/O modules per enclosure | |
 |  | |
Host/Expansion Interface | Three universal ×4 12 Gb/s mini-SAS connectors (SFF-8644) per I/O module | |
 |  | |
Management/Status Reporting | CLI via RS232 and 100Base-T port, SCSI enclosure services (SES) via SAS SFF-8644 ports | |
 |  | |
Maximum System Configuration | Dual host-connected enclosure with a maximum expanded configuration of 4 enclosures for a total of 336 drives | |
 |  | |
Device Support | Dual-ported 12 Gb/s SAS | |
 |  | |
Max Drives per Enclosure | 84 (for a full list of supported drives, please contact your account or sales manager) | |
 |  | |
Hot-Swappable Components | Drives, power supply units (PSU), cooling modules, side planes, and SBB I/O modules | |
 |  | |
Physical | Height: 220 mm / 8.65 in (5 EIA units) | Width: 483 mm / 19 in (IEC rack compliant) | Depth: 933 mm / 36.75 in | Weight: | |
135 kg / 298 lb (with drives, no rail kit) | ||
 | ||
Power Requirements — AC Input |  | |
Input Power Requirements | 180VAC-240VAC, 50Hz/60Hz | |
 |  | |
Max Power Output per PSU | 2200W | |
 |  | |
Environmental/Temperature Ranges | Â | |
Operating/Non-operating Altitude | –100 m to 3000 m (–330 ft to 10,000 ft) / –100 m to 12,192 m (–330 ft to 40,000 ft) | |
 |  | |
Operating/Non-operating Temperature | ASHRAE A2, 5°C to 35°C (41°F to 95°F), derate 1°C / 300m above 900m, 20°C / hr max rate of change / –40°C to | |
70°C (–40°F to 158°F) | ||
 | ||
 |  | |
Operating/Non-operating Humidity | –12°C DP and 10% RH to 21°C DP and 80% RH, max DP 21°C / 5% to 100% non-condensing | |
 |  | |
Operating/Non-operating Shock | 5 Gs, 10ms, half sine pulses/20 Gs, 10ms, half sine pulses | |
 |  | |
Operating/Non-operating Vibration | 0.21 Gs rms (5-500Hz) / 1.04 Gs rms (2-200Hz) | |
